ECLB75W SERIES
75 WATT 4:1 INPUT
DC-DC CONVERTERS
︳
FEATURES
* 75W Isolated Output
* Efficiency to 92.5%
* Low No Load Power Consumption
* 2.05’’x1.2x0.4’’ Six-Sided Shield Metal Case
* Standard 2”X1” Pin Out Compatible
* 4:1 Input Range
* Regulated Outputs
* Fixed Switching Frequency
* Input Under Voltage Protection
* Over Current Protection
* Remote On/Off
* Continuous Short Circuit Protection
* No Tantalum Capacitor Inside
* Safety Meets IEC/EN/UL62368-1
* Full Load Operation Up to 54℃ with Heat-Sink

SPECIFICATIONS
All Specifications Typical At Nominal Line, Full Load, and 25℃ Unless Otherwise Noted
INPUT SPECIFICATIONS:
GENERAL SPECIFICATIONS:
Input Voltage Range ....……………..............…. 24VDC ................ 9 – 36VDC
48VDC ….…..…. 18 – 75VDC
Input Surge Voltage (100ms max.) ………….. 24VDC ……...... 50VDC max.
48VDC ….…... 100VDC max.
Under Voltage Lockout …………... 24Vin Power Up .……..……. 8.5VDC typ.
24Vin Power Down ….…….. 7.8VDC typ.
48Vin Power Up ….….....….16VDC typ.
48Vin Power Down ……......15VDC typ.
Input Filter (note6) .………………………………..……….……………. PI Type
Remote On/Off Control (note3&4)
Efficiency ................................................……..………............ See Table
Isolation Voltage ................ Input/Output ..........…..….….. 2250VDC min.
Input/Case, Output/Case ..... 1600VDC min.
9
Isolation Resistance …..................……….……….………. 10 ohm min.
Isolation Capacitance ……. Input/Output …..........……..…… 1500pF typ.
Input/Case, Output/Case ……... 1000pF typ.
Switching Frequency .......... Single …. 270KHz typ, Dual … 330KHz typ.
EMI/RFI ………………………………....…. Six-Sided Continuous Shield
Operating Ambient Temperature Range ...…..…...…….... -40℃ to +85℃
De-rating, Above 22℃ (note5) …..…. Linearly to Zero Power at +105℃
OUTPUT SPECIFICATIONS:
Case Temperature (note5) …….…………………………….. 105℃ max.
Voltage Accuracy ………………....………..……….......……...…… ±1.0% max.
Voltage Balance (Dual) …….…..………………………….…….…. ±1.0% max.
Transient Response: 75%~100% Step Load Change
Cooling ………………………………………………… Natural Convection
Storage Temperature Range ...……..........……....…....... -55℃ to +125℃
Temperature Coefficient ....................….………...…..……….. ±0.02%/℃ max.
Thermal Shutdown, Case Temp. .………….....................……. 110℃ typ.
Humidity ................................................. 95% RH max. Non-Condensing
MTBF … MIL-HDBK-217F, GB, 25℃ , Full Load
Vo=5V 904Khrs typ., Vo=12V 840Khrs typ., Vo=15V 995Khrs typ.
Vo=±12V 792Khrs typ., Vo=±15V 998Khrs typ., Vo=±24V 691Khrs typ.
Shock/Vibration ……………………..……………… Meet MIL-STD-810F
Dimensions ....................... 2.05x1.20x0.40 inches (52.0x30.5x10.2 mm)
Line Regulation (note1) .……..……. Single/Dual ......................…. ±0.2% max.
Load Regulation (note2) .……..…. Single/Dual ....................…. ±0.5% max.
Case Material ………………….… Aluminum with Non-Conductive Base
Weight ………………………………………………………………….. 39g
Cross Regulation (Dual Output) Load Cross Variation 10%/100% ... ±5% max.
NOTE :
Over Voltage Protection ………………….…….………… Zener or TVS Clamp
Current Limit ………………………………….…. 110% - 160% Nominal Output
Output Short Circuit Protection .............................. Continuous (Hiccup Mode)
External Trim Adj. Range …………………………………..………. +10%, -20%
Start Up Time ……………………………………………………………. 30ms typ.
1. Measured from high line to low line.
2. Measured from full load to min. load.
3. Logic compatibility … CMOS or open collector TTL, refer to –Vin.
Module on ……………...… >3.5VDC to 75VDC or open circuit
Module off ………………..……………….………. 0 to < 1.2VDC
4. Suffix "N" to the model number with negative logic remote on/off
Module on ………….…….……………………..…. 0 to < 1.2 VDC
Module off …………...…..….. >3.5VDC to 75VDC or open circuit
5. Maximum case temperature under any operating condition should
not be exceeded 105℃.
6. An external input capacitor 100uF for 48Vin models and 220uF for
24Vin models are recommended to reduce input ripple voltage.
